摘要
Reactions of (eta-5-C5H5)Re(NO)(PPh3)(SiMe2H) (1) and CHCl3, CBr4, and CHI3 give halosilyl complexes (eta-5-C5H5)Re(NO)(PPh3)(SiMe2X) [X = Cl (2), Br (3), I (4); 66-84%]. Addition of Me3SiOTf to 2 gives triflate (eta-5-C5H5)Re(NO)(PPh3)(SiMe2OTf) (5; 97%), which in turn reacts with (Me2N)3S+ [SiMe3F2]- to give (eta-5-C5H5)Re(NO)(PPh3)(SiMe2F) (6; 77%). Reaction of 5 and pyridine gives the base-stabilized silylene complex [(eta-5-C5H5)Re(NO)(PPh3){SiMe2(NC5H5)}]+TfO- (7; 84%). CH2Cl2 solutions of (eta-5-C5H5)Re(NO)(PPh3)(CH3) (8) or 2 and Lewis acids are studied by IR and NMR. As assayed by IR, 8/ECl3 solutions (E = B, Al) show ReNO - ECl3 (major) and Re - ECl3 (minor) adducts. Solutions of 2/BCl3 show analogous adducts (-78-degrees-C), and in the presence of excess BCl3 (eta-5-C5H5)Re(NO-BCl3)(PPh3)(SiMe2Cl) (11) crystallizes. Solutions of 2/AlCl3 show uncomplexed 2 and Re-AlCl3 (major) and ReNO - AlCl3 (minor) adducts. In contrast to 2-7 and 2/BCl3, H-1- and C-13-NMR spectra of 2/AlCl3 suggest an equilibrium with the base-free silylene complex [(eta-5-C5H5)Re(NO)(PPh3)(= SiMe2)]+X+.
